About Shaodan Chen

Shaodan Chen is a scholar working on Pharmacology, Molecular Biology, Nephrology, Pharmacology and Plant Science, having authored 51 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fungal Biology and Applications (24 papers), Gout, Hyperuricemia, Uric Acid (12 papers), Pharmacological Effects of Natural Compounds (10 papers), Climate variability and models (7 papers),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(6 papers), Polysaccharides and Plant Cell Walls (5 papers), Medicinal plant effects and applications (5 papers) and Hydrology and Drought Analysis (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acology (418 citations), Pharmacology (221 citations), Nephrology (172 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(136 citations) and Biochemistry (51 citations). Shaodan Chen has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Macao. Frequent co-authors include Yizhen Xie, Tianqiao Yong, Jiyan Su, Chunwei Jiao, Diling Chen, Liping Zhang, Huiping Hu, Chun Xiao, Qingping Wu and Xiong Gao. Their work appears in journals such as Water, Biomedicine & Pharmacotherapy, Food Chemistry X, Frontiers in Pharmacology and Journal of Functional Foods.
